Renovation of the Cinémathèque

Our beloved cinema on Place du Théâtre closed in September 2025 for extensive renovations. Led by the City of Luxembourg in partnership with Fabeck Architects, the renovation is designed to preserve the character of the historic building while bringing it up to the standards of a modern 21st-century cinema.

Why a Renovation

The Cinémathèque is a cherished historic building, but its facilities have aged and no longer meet modern standards of comfort, safety, functionality, and accessibility.

Renovations planned from 2026 to 2029 aim to provide all visitors with a high-quality experience.

Key goals include improving accessibility for people with reduced mobility, upgrading safety and comfort, modernizing technical equipment, and optimizing the spaces to better welcome audiences.

Renovation Timeline

Transforming the Cinémathèque is a major undertaking that takes time and attention.

Each stage — from renovation to modernization and expansion — aims to preserve the building’s character while meeting the needs of today and the future.

Étape 00

September-October 2024

Submission of the final execution project (PDD) and building permit applications

Étape 01

November 2024

Beginning of plans and submissions from the project offices

Étape 02

June 2025

Start of project submissions from the design offices

Étape 03

January 2026

Work on site begins

Étape 04

February 2028

Work on the outdoor areas begins

Étape 05

February 2029

Expected completion of the work

New locations, same great films!

While the renovations are underway, the Cinémathèque’s screenings will be hosted at several locations around the city, including the Théâtre des Capucins and the Cercle Cité.

Each month, depending on availability, audiences can continue to enjoy their favourites — Cinema Paradiso, Afternoon Adventures, Great Restorations, Comedy Classics, and many more surprises.
